gene PCS1, sequence comparisons and phylogenetic analysis, recombinant expression in Arabidopsis thaliana Col-0 ecotype, and induction by Cd2+, functional recombinant expression in Saccharomyces cerevisiae YK44 highly Cd2+-sensitive strain conferring Cd resistance. Compared to PCS2 and 3 expressing lines, the AdPCS1 transformant has a longer lag phase, resulting in slower initial growth. This difference is rescued after 24 h, with the growth kinetics of the AdPCS1 transformant becoming normal, indicating that the difference results from decreased translational efficiency Arundo donax
gene PCS2, sequence comparisons and phylogenetic analysis, recombinant expression in Arabidopsis thaliana Col-0 ecotype, and induction by Cd2+, functional recombinant expression in Saccharomyces cerevisiae YK44 highly Cd-sensitive strain conferring Cd2+ resistance Arundo donax
gene PCS3, sequence comparisons and phylogenetic analysis, recombinant expression in Arabidopsis thaliana Col-0 ecotype, and induction by Cd2+, functional recombinant expression in Saccharomyces cerevisiae YK44 highly Cd-sensitive strain conferring Cd2+ resistance Arundo donax

additional information PC2 is the main polymerization product of PCS1, followed by PC3, low amount of PC4 formation. PCS1 has the highest activity of the three isozymes, PCS3 the lowest Arundo donax ?

evolution evolution and functional differentiation of the recently diverged three phytochelatin synthase genes from Arundo donax, phylogenetic analysis and evolutionary modeling, overview. AdPCS1-3 proteins are significantly less divergent than other duplicated PCSs, displaying only 25-29 substitutions. All the canonical features of PCSs are present, namely the catalytic triad Cys56, His162, and Asp180. The lengths of both N- and C-terminal domains are comparable to those of previously validated PCSs. AdPCS1-3 genes evolved at different evolutionary rates Arundo donax
physiological function phytochelatin synthases (PCSs) play pivotal roles in the detoxification of heavy metals and metalloids in plants Arundo donax
